  14 vectron international ?267 lowell road, hudson, nh 03051 ?tel: 1-88-vectron-1 ?web: www.vectron.com voltage controlled crystal oscillators (vcxos) performance characteristics j-type pecl output option description: low jitter capable, pecl output vcxo in a 14mm x 9mm smd package. features: output frequencies from 15 mhz to 180 mhz ?3.3 or 5 volt options ?small 14mm x 9mm j-lead package ?complementary pecl output ?low phase noise and custom options ?0/70? or ?0/85? operating temperature ?enable/disable (pecl) center frequency, see ordering information f o 15 180 mhz supply voltage 1 , 5.0 volt option 4.5 5.0 5.5 vdc 3.3 volt option 3.0 3.3 3.6 vdc maximum supply voltage 7 v supply current 65 ma output level high (0/70?) v oh vcc-1.025 - vcc-0.880 v output level low (0/70?) v ol vcc-1.810 - vcc-1.620 v output level high (-40/+85?) v oh vcc-1.085 - vcc-0.880 v output level low (-40/+85?) v ol vcc-1.830 - vcc-1.555 v output rise and fall time t r /t f 1ns symmetry (duty cycle) sym 45 55 % operating temperature, see ordering info t op 0/70, -40/85 ? rms jitter, 155.52 mhz, 12 khz to 20 mhz offset 0.5 1.0 ps absolute pull range over the operating apr 32, 50 ppm temperature range, aging and power supply. vc= 0.5 to 4.5 supply or 0.3 to 3.0v at 3.3 supply. see ordering information for options maximum control voltage 0 vcc transfer function: k v positive (frequency vs. control voltage) control input leakage i l 0.1 ma control voltage modulation bandwidth bw 10 khz storage temperature t s -55 - 125 ? soldering temp./time t ls - - 220/10 ?/s package size: 14mm x 9 mm x 4.5 mm parameter symbol minimum typical maximum unit 1. power supply bypass is required and a 0.1uf in parallel with a 0.01uf high frequency capacitor is recommended. 2. transition times are measured from 20% to 80% of a full 10k ecl level swing. 8798_aa's vectron 05/30/02 3:11 pm page 14
vectron international ?267 lowell road, hudson, nh 03051 ?tel: 1-88-vectron-1 ?web: www.vectron.com 15 voltage controlled crystal oscillators (vcxos) outline drawing dimensions are in inches and (millimeters) 0.118 (3.00) 0.200 (5.08) 0.100 (2.54) 0.346 (8.80) 0.050 (1.27) recommended solder pad layout 1 vc vcxo control voltage. 2 n/c or e/d 1 no connect or output disable option 3 gnd case and electrical ground. 4 output vcxo output 5c output vcxo complementary output 6v cc power supply voltage (5 v or 3.3v 10%) pin out information for the pecl output option 1. by setting pin 2 high, the outputs are disabled and output on pin 4 is held low while complementary output on pin 5 is held high. output is enabled by setting pin 2 at < vcc -1.6v, see ordering information for enable/disable option. pin symbol function j-type ordering information 77.76 mhz 82.944 mhz 139.264 mhz 155.52 mhz 161.1328 mhz 166.6286 mhz standard frequencies mm in t emperature range c = 0 to 70? l = -40 to 85? frequency 15 mhz to 180 mhz g u l m e 77.760 package: 6-pin ceramic soj supply v oltage c = 5.0 vdc 10% d = 3.3 vdc 10% output u = vcxo l = 10% linear vcxo m = 20 ppm stability vcxo apr f = 32 ppm g = 50 ppm mhz specials n = standard p = 6 ps rms (<1ps rms 12 khz - 20 mhz offset) jitter duty cycle m = pecl 45/55% p t ri-state u = none e = enable/disable on pin 2 d j vcxo 8798_aa's vectron 05/30/02 3:11 pm page 15
